What to check before for buildings with rent-stabilized apartments near the A train in Manhattan

  • Expect a mix of building ages and layouts, but the key filter is rent-stabilized. Still verify the exact unit’s rent-stabilized status and renewal terms with the landlord/management.
  • Use the A-train filter as a commute check, then confirm walking time, transfer needs, and service days with your route plan.
  • Before applying, ask about move-in costs beyond rent (deposit, fees, any brokers’ charges) and when they’re due.
  • Check pet rules, laundry setup, and any building policies that affect daily life. Filters don’t replace the building’s own documentation.
  • If you’re comparing multiple buildings, use the review/Q&A sections to spot recurring issues like maintenance response time or package handling.
